Rookie Registered: August 07, 2008 Posts: 53 | who do you guys think was the best wrestler to never win a title in high school? |
World Champion Location: Wayne, America Registered: October 20, 2002 Posts: 5714 | Chris Trampe of Ord was a four-time runner-up, the only one in state history. Kind of hard to top that.
